Northweather, Martin lead Blair Oaks to district win

LINN, Mo. - Based on their first matchup this season, the Blair Oaks Falcons knew it wasn't going to be easy getting past the Linn Wildcats in the first round of district play.

Linn only trailed by three points entering the fourth quarter Wednesday, but Trent Martin and Eric Northweather combined to score 23 points in the fourth quarter to lead the Falcons to a 73-58 victory in the Class 3 District 9 Tournament.

On Jan. 25 in Wardsville, Blair Oaks and Linn traded the lead six times in the first quarter before the Falcons created some cushion in the second and third quarters in a 58-40 win.

It took Blair Oaks, the No. 2 seed, until the fourth quarter to pull away from seventh-seeded Linn on Wednesday.

The Falcons led 21-17 after the first quarter, 33-26 at halftime and 45-42 entering the fourth after Linn outscored Blair Oaks 16-12 in the third.

Martin scored 12 of his 22 points in the fourth quarter, while Northweather tallied 11 of his game-high 32 points in the final eight minutes.

Caleb Maassen scored 18 points and Jackson Voss added 14 for Linn, which ends its season at 15-11.

Blair Oaks (21-5), winners of 15 straight games, will face third-seeded Southern Boone at 6 p.m. Friday in the semifinals. The Eagles defeated sixth-seeded South Callaway 67-35 Wednesday.

Top-seeded Father Tolton defeated eighth-seeded Fatima 56-40 Wednesday to advance to the semifinals. The Trailblazers will take on fourth-seeded North Callaway at 7:30 p.m. Friday.
